About

Simone Elsig is a scholar working on Biomedical Engineering, Pharmacology and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, Simone Elsig has authored 12 papers receiving a total of 1.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 5 papers in Biomedical Engineering, 4 papers in Pharmacology and 4 papers in Surgery. Recurrent topics in Simone Elsig’s work include Neuroscience and Neural Engineering (4 papers), Musculoskeletal pain and rehabilitation (4 papers) and Muscle activation and electromyography studies (4 papers). Simone Elsig is often cited by papers focused on Neuroscience and Neural Engineering (4 papers), Musculoskeletal pain and rehabilitation (4 papers) and Muscle activation and electromyography studies (4 papers). Simone Elsig collaborates with scholars based in Switzerland, Italy and Germany. Simone Elsig's co-authors include Claudio Castellini, Henning Müller, Manfredo Atzori, Anne-Gabrielle Mittaz Hager, Arjan Gijsberts, Barbara Caputo, Giorgio Giatsidis, Franco Bassetto, Jan Taeymans and Roger Hilfiker and has published in prestigious journals such as British Journal of Sports Medicine, IEEE Transactions on Neural Systems and Rehabilitation Engineering and Scientific Data.
